Ryzlink Vlašský VOC 2018
Vino Marcinčák

Vino Marcinčák is a family winery founded in 1990. It is the largest Certified BIO winery in the Czech Republic with 110 hectares of vineyards under cultivation. It produces high quality white and red varieties, many with VOC designation. However, it is known as one of the top producers of “straw wine” within the world. The Winery is located in the wine sub-region Mikulov | Moravia.

Petr Marcinčák is the owner and current winemaker. He has been Czech BIO Winemaker of the Year for several years running, and is an active member of the prestigious Mikulov “Aliance Vinařů V8” (V8 Alliance) and the European Order of Knights of Wine.

This wine is 100 % Welschriesling and is VOC for the Mikulov sub-region.

Tasting Notes & Pairing Suggestions
  • This wine is lighter in body with fresh acidity
  • It pairs beautifully with salads, grilled fish and seafood
  • On the palate you’ll taste honey, sweet citrus and walnut
  • Serving Temperature: 9-10°C
  • This wine can be cellared for up to 4 years after vintage
Analytics
Residual Sugar: 8.7 g/L
Acid: 6.5 g/L
Alcohol: 12%
